In "A Woman's Power," Louisa May Alcott explores themes of female strength and empowerment through the lens of 19th-century societal expectations. The novel is characterized by Alcott's signature blend of realism and romanticism, vividly depicting the struggles and triumphs of its female protagonists as they navigate personal ambitions in a patriarchal world. Set against the backdrop of burgeoning feminist movements, the narrative reflects a pivotal moment in literary history when women began to assert their voices, making this work an essential study for understanding the evolution of women's literature. Louisa May Alcott, renowned for her iconic novel "Little Women," draws from her own experiences and observations of women's roles in society to craft this compelling narrative. Growing up in a progressive household influenced by Transcendentalist ideals, Alcott was acutely aware of the limitations placed on women of her time. Her dedication to social reform and advocacy for women's rights is palpably infused in the characters and scenarios she portrays, making this novel a personal manifesto of sorts.
